Get Your House Ready For The Summer Market 

If you are considering selling your property in the near future, then you are probably wondering how to get your house ready for the summer market. Even mild winters like we just had are difficult for buyers and sellers. Most buyers who can wait for the warmer weather come out of hibernation when the temperatures rise.  

Now, selling a house can be an arduous process. From the moment you decide to list, to getting the listing live, can be quite the slog. Everything you do should be to attract buyers. The best way to do that is to make sure everything about your house looks the best it can.  

That’s not a groundbreaking statement, but it is true.  

Over my years as a real estate agent in Philadelphia, Bucks and Montgomery Counties, I have seen my fair share of properties listed in each of the seasons. Weather plays a big part in buyers and their mindset going into each property. So, here are a few tips to get your house ready for the summer market:  

  1. Lawn And Garden First: Curb appeal is a real aspect of home buying and selling. The first impression buyers have of your property is the lawn and landscaping. So, focus on cleaning up those flower beds and keeping your lawn in check. Seed and water any parts of your lawn that are not growing to help get them moving in the right direction. 
  2. Declutter: This goes for all seasons but especially in the summer. Whether they are aware of it or not, buyers like clean and minimally staged spaces in the summer months. Move the extra furniture, the army of storage bins stashed in every available space, and anything else you can go without into a garage or a storage space if you can afford one. 
  3. Simple Fixes: Go around your house and make a list of all the little things you can handle fixing on your own. Paint touchups, squeaky door hinges, light fixtures that need to be cleaned…all of that kind of stuff. Then use that as your map for getting your house market ready. 
  4. Bigger Fixes: This is where consulting with an experienced realtor comes in handy. Redoing a whole bathroom or putting new carpeting in isn’t always going to increase the value of your house.
